T-Mobile drops Galaxy S4 price by $50 for one month

Shailesh Shrivastava

There is some good news for people who are on T-Mobile network and want to buy the new Samsung Galaxy S4 smartphone. The new Samsung Galaxy S4, which was earlier being sold for $149.99 down payment and $20 per month for 24 months, will now be available for just $99.99 down payment while the monthly installment remains the same.

The $50 discount is being offered by T-Mobile only for a month (from June 12 to July 13) and after that the buyers will have to shell out the same amount they were required to earlier.

It's not only the Galaxy S4 that is being offered for a lower price by T-Mobile. The carrier has also reduced the pricing of Samsung Galaxy S3 and the Galaxy Note 2.

The Samsung Galaxy Note 2 will be available with T-Mobile for $169.99 down payment and $20 installment for 24 months whereas the Galaxy S3 will be available for $49.99 down payment with 24 monthly installments of $20.

"People told us we'd be crazy to drop our price on the hot-selling Galaxy S4 when we already offer such a low-out-of-pocket cost - so we did it," said Mike Sievert, chief marketing officer, T-Mobile US.

"Some of our competitors require customers to sign a restrictive two year service contract or participate in a complicated trade-in scheme to get to their advertised price. We decided to just give customers the phone they want at the out of pocket cost they are asking for. That's what you strive to do when you are America's Un-carrier."

If the price drop from T-Mobile has made you excited, then T-Mobile is going to deliver more excitement as it has also dropped the price of iPhone 4 and LG Optimus L9 smartphones.
